Drug treatment services for the hearing impaired are accessible in both an outpatient and inpatient setting. People with hearing impairment can be at a greater risk of addiction problems due to their impairment. living with a major handicap can be a root cause for discouragement, depression and apathy for both adults and adolescents who may turn to drugs or alcohol to deal with these feelings. Hearing impaired treatment services are available in Placerville to help resolve addiction for these clients, with ASL and other assistance which offers recovery and treatment information and education in writing so that patients aren't hindered from getting better as a result of their disability.

Addiction treatment programs that have full time staff to help the hearing impaired are the most ideal programs to consider. Some facilities may only employ part-time staff to interpret and assist this demographic, and this means hearing impaired clients won't benefit as much as everyone else and will miss out on vital activities they should be participating in daily. There may be video presentations available which use sign language as well, which is also really helpful.

There are agencies and organizations which can give hearing impaired people struggling with addiction with information and resources to find the treatment services they need. One of these is the Deaf Off Drugs and Alcohol (DODA).
